
如何分析一个Java项目案例
用户关注问题
分析Java项目案例时应关注哪些核心部分?
在分析一个Java项目案例时,应该重点查看哪些关键模块或组件以理解项目的整体结构?
关注项目的结构和关键模块
应重点关注项目的包结构、主要类及其职责、模块之间的依赖关系以及关键业务逻辑的实现。理解项目的入口点、配置文件以及常用的设计模式也非常重要,这有助于把握项目的整体架构。
如何有效理解Java项目中的业务流程?
面对一个复杂的Java项目案例,认清业务流程的步骤和数据流该如何进行?
通过用例和流程图理清业务逻辑
可以从业务需求和用例出发,结合项目中的类关系和方法调用,绘制流程图或者时序图来帮助理解业务的执行流程。此外,阅读关键方法的代码实现,关注数据在不同组件之间的传递也能理清业务流程。
分析Java项目代码时如何提升效率?
在阅读和理解Java项目案例代码的过程中,有哪些技巧能帮助快速掌握项目内容?
利用工具辅助和分步分析
利用IDE的查找引用、跳转定义和代码调试功能能快速定位重点代码。分模块逐步阅读,先理解核心功能模块,再逐渐涉及辅助模块。结合项目文档和注释,逐层深入,避免盲目查看代码。